Deck Construction in Boston, MA
Deck construction services encompass the design and building of outdoor platforms attached to residential properties, providing additional space for relaxation, entertaining, or enjoying the outdoors. These projects can range from simple, small decks to expansive multi-level structures, often customized to match the style of the home and the needs of the property owner. When considering a deck addition, homeowners typically want to understand the materials available, the durability of different options, and how the new structure will integrate with existing outdoor spaces.
Property owners interested in deck construction should consider factors such as the size and layout of the deck, the intended use,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. It's also important to think about maintenance requirements, weather resistance, and the overall aesthetic appeal.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project aligns with personal preferences and property features before requesting a quote or planning the construction process.

Deck Construction Questions
What types of decks can be built? Deck construction services typically include wood, composite, and vinyl deck options to suit different styles and needs.
Is it possible to customize a deck design? Yes, customization options often include various layouts, railing styles, and built-in features to match property preferences.
What materials are commonly used for deck construction? Common materials include pressure-treated lumber, cedar, composite boards, and PVC, chosen for durability and appearance.
Can a deck be added to an existing outdoor space? Yes, many projects involve building new decks adjacent to existing patios or yards to expand outdoor living areas.
